    The Implications of the electronic money issuance contract
    (Oum El Bouaghi University, 2022) Boukhalfa, Hadda
    In view of the adoption of electronic money in banking services, it was necessary to develop a legal framework for its regulation and to determine the relationship arising from its management, and this study aims to address the effects associated with the use of electronic money issuing contract. As a result of the study, it can be said that the contract for the issuance of electronic money is one of the legal issues that express the nature of the legal relationship between the consumer and the exporter. It is difficult to describe it in the traditional legal form.
